Economic Support Specialist
Jackson County is seeking to fill an Economic Support Specialist position at the Department of Health and Human Services. This position serves as a primary contact for persons seeking help through Public Assistance. This position determinations and completes case management of Economic Support Programs. Duties include screening, interviewing, and gathering and verifying information to determine eligibility when processing applications and renewals; re-determine eligibility based on reported changes and; accurately maintaining all financial and other data relevant to consortium cases and case management.
Requirements: A High School Diploma or equivalent. Post-secondary coursework in Business Administration, Economics, Accounting or Communications along with experience in income maintenance preferred. Possess and maintain a valid Wisconsin Driver’s license. Economic Support New Worker Training and CARES/CWW Certification must be obtained within six months of hire.
2021 Wage Range: $15.31 – $19.14 per hour plus excellent County benefit package and State retirement plan.
